Based on the market analysis, fabric technology review, buyer feedback insights, and Alibaba.com category data, here are actionable recommendations for Southeast Asian suppliers considering compression sleeves and knee sleeves sourcing opportunities:
1. Prioritize Arm Sleeves, Monitor Knee Sleeves
The 346% YoY growth in arm sleeves combined with mature market classification indicates sustainable demand. Allocate primary production capacity and marketing investment to arm sleeve configurations. For knee sleeves, maintain minimal viable inventory while monitoring the 299.7% QoQ demand surge—if sustained over 2-3 months, consider expanding knee sleeve offerings.

4. Segment Product Lines by Use Case
User feedback reveals distinct buyer segments with different priorities. Develop clear product line segmentation:
- Performance Line: Premium fabrics, UV protection, moisture-wicking focus for athletes
- Medical Line: Certified compression levels, clinical documentation for healthcare buyers
- Wellness Line: Comfort-focused, fashion colors, accessible pricing for general consumers
- Occupational Line: Durability emphasis, bulk packaging for corporate/industrial buyers
5. Leverage User Feedback for Product Development
The hot weather limitation pain point (users avoiding compression in warm conditions) represents a clear product development opportunity. Suppliers developing ultra-breathable fabrics, targeted cooling technologies, or strategic ventilation zones could capture underserved demand. 7. Start with Focused SKU Selection
Rather than launching 20+ variations, begin with 3-5 strategically chosen SKUs representing different price points and use cases. Example starter lineup: (1) Standard polyester-spandex arm sleeve, (2) Premium nylon-spandex with SPF 50+, (3) Medical-grade compression sleeve with certified mmHg, (4) Knee sleeve (monitoring demand trend), (5) Fashion/lifestyle color variant.
